It's uncommon to rely on temporary lifetime extension when having a regular, non-`const&` value behaves identically. Since `Twine::str` and `buildFixMsgForStringFlag` both return regular `std::string`s, there's seemingly no point in having `const&` here. llvm-svn: 361457
